AGOURA HILLS, Calif. & CONCORD, Calif.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--National Veterinary Associates ("NVA"), a global community of 1,150 best-in-class veterinary hospitals and SAGE Veterinary Centers ("SAGE"), a premier provider of specialty and emergency medicine, today announced that SAGE has agreed to join forces with NVA Compassion-First, NVA's specialty and emergency veterinary group. million members through originating and managing a diversified portfolio ), Support in marketing and IT (better access to advanced technologies and marketing tools, facilitated client acquisition, etc.). The senior management team at National Veterinary Associates will stay with the Agoura Hills, California, company and retain minority ownership. NVA, owned by German private equity firm JAB, agreed to acquire Sage last year when it had 16 hospitals.
